数据预警模型是一种能够及时发现数据异常、预测未来趋势并给出相应建议的模型。在企业运营、风险管理、市场营销等方面,数据预警模型具有重要的应用价值。本文将详细介绍如何搭建一个强大的数据预警模型,内容将分为以下七个段落:
1. 明确目标和范围
我们需要明确数据预警模型的目标和范围。具体包括以下几点:
- 确定预警模型的应用场景,例如:风险管理、市场营销、客户服务、供应链管理等;
- 定义预警模型的目标,例如:降低风险、提高客户满意度、优化库存管理等;
- 确定预警模型的数据来源和数据类型,例如:企业内部数据、外部数据、结构化数据、非结构化数据等;
- 明确预警模型的评估指标,例如:准确率、召回率、F1值等。
2. 数据预处理
数据预处理是搭建预警模型的关键环节,主要包括以下几个方面:
- 数据清洗:处理缺失值、异常值、重复值等问题,提高数据质量;
- 数据集成:将不同来源的数据整合在一起,形成完整的数据集;
- 数据转换:将非结构化数据转换为结构化数据,便于模型处理;
- 特征工程:从原始数据中提取对预警目标有用的特征,降低模型的复杂度。
3. 选择合适的模型
根据预警目标的不同,选择合适的模型进行搭建。常见的预警模型包括:
- 分类模型:支持向量机(SVM)、决策树、随机森林、朴素贝叶斯等;
- 回归模型:线性回归、逻辑回归、时间序列分析等;
- 聚类模型:K-means、DBSCAN等;
- 图模型:图卷积神经网络(GCN)、图注意力机制(GAT)等。
4. 模型训练与调优
在训练模型时,需要注意以下几点:
- 划分训练集、验证集和测试集,避免过拟合;
- 选择合适的优化算法,例如:梯度下降、随机梯度下降、牛顿法等;
- 调整模型参数,通过交叉验证选择最优参数组合;
- 监控训练过程中的异常情况,例如:训练误差和验证误差波动较大、模型过拟合等。
5. 模型评估与优化
模型评估是判断模型效果的重要环节,主要包括以下几个方面:
- 评估指标:准确率、召回率、F1值、ROC曲线、AUC等;
- 对比实验:通过与现有方法进行对比,验证模型的有效性;
- 模型优化:根据评估结果,调整模型结构、参数或特征工程方法,提高模型效果。
6. 模型部署与应用
模型部署是将训练好的模型应用到实际场景的过程,主要包括以下几个方面:
- 实时数据处理:将实时数据与模型进行结合,实现预警功能;
- 结果可视化:将预警结果以图表、报告等形式展示给用户;
- 持续优化:根据实际应用效果,持续调整模型参数或结构,提高预警效果。
7. 持续监控与迭代
数据预警模型是一个持续迭代的过程,需要定期进行监控和优化,主要包括以下几个方面:
- 监控预警模型的运行状态,发现异常情况;
- 定期对模型进行评估,验证模型效果;
- 根据实际情况,对模型进行优化和升级;
- 跟踪预警模型在实际应用中的效果,不断改进和完善。
搭建一个强大的数据预警模型需要明确目标和范围、进行数据预处理、选择合适的模型、训练与调优模型、评估与优化模型、部署与应用模型以及持续监控与迭代。在这个过程中,我们需要关注模型的各个方面,确保模型能够有效地预警数据异常并给出相应建议。
更多数据治理相关资料请咨询客服获取,或者直接拨打电话:020-83342506
立即免费申请产品试用
申请试用